Used Honda FIT Prices by Year

As of July 2026, a used Honda FIT typically lists for $11,294 in the US. Depending on model year, typical asking prices run from $5,688 for a 2007 to $18,900 for a 2020 — every figure below is a national median of 1,717 live listings, not a book value, and the FIT steps down a median 10.2% per model year of age.

Honda FIT price by model year

YearTypical priceMost listings fall betweenAvg mileageEPA combinedNCAPFor sale
2020 $18,900 $12,997 – $23,379 59,378 mi 31–36 MPG 5★ 110
2019 $16,339 $11,459 – $20,994 72,066 mi 31–36 MPG 5★ 175
2018 $15,742 $10,900 – $20,988 80,872 mi 31–36 MPG 5★ 145
2017 $14,212 $9,900 – $18,027 86,946 mi 32–36 MPG 5★ 111
2016 $12,950 $8,997 – $17,866 94,220 mi 32–36 MPG 5★ 207
2015 $11,294 $7,925 – $15,995 104,099 mi 32–36 MPG 5★ 336
2013 $8,900 $6,500 – $12,981 116,507 mi 29–31 MPG · 118 MPGe 4★ 159
2012 $7,995 $5,028 – $11,997 133,724 mi 29–31 MPG 4★ 77
2011 $8,594 $5,739 – $11,994 129,312 mi 29–31 MPG 77
2010 $7,999 $4,995 – $10,999 133,782 mi 29–31 MPG 87
2009 $7,820 $4,438 – $10,787 131,670 mi 29–31 MPG 108
2008 $6,343 $3,612 – $9,138 154,245 mi 29–31 MPG 74
2007 $5,688 $4,149 – $7,999 147,924 mi 29–31 MPG 51

“Typical price” is the national median asking price; the range covers the middle 80% of listings (10th–90th percentile), so it excludes teaser and outlier prices on both ends.

Cheapest Honda FIT

The cheapest quotable model year is the 2007, typically listing for $5,688 (most between $4,149 and $7,999) with an average odometer of 147,924 miles. Before chasing the lowest price, weigh mileage against a one-year-newer car — each model year of age saves a median 10.2%, and the per-year table above shows where the price-per-mile balance is best. How fast does the Honda FIT depreciate?

Across adjacent model years currently on the market, the FIT steps down a median 10.2% per model year of age — e.g. moving one year older typically saves about that share of the price.
